Eat along the course and grab a bourbon at the Marriott
The Marriott Lexington Griffin Gate Golf Resort & Spa offers much more than upscale lodging. One of a few dining establishments at the resort, the Bluegrass Bistro serves a variety of farm to table meals. Guests have the option of enjoying their dinners and drinks on the outdoor patio with views of the course’s tree-lined fairways. Patrons can help themselves to the hotel’s bourbon machines and relax in one of the seats around the Tasting Loft’s electric fire pit. The hotel can also be one of several stops during a whiskey tasting adventure as it’s located on the famous Kentucky Bourbon Trail. Other dining options near Winburn and Griffin Gate include Tachibana Japanese off Newtown Pike. The menu includes sushi, tempura options and ramen, all of which are served in a setting with traditional decor like shoji style panels placed alongside the windows. While it is a few neighborhoods away, many often stop by MiMi’s Southern Style Cooking on New Circle to pick up combo orders of fried chicken, greens and macaroni and cheese. Just up the road from MiMi’s is an ALDI and Walmart. Although it’s not officially part of the community, the Griffin Gate Golf Club adjoins Griffin Gate and is a popular destination. In addition to the 18-hole championship course, members have access to both outdoor and indoor pools and a fitness center that comes complete with a variety of strength training equipment. Neighborhood children and teens in Winburn often find themselves at the 37-acre Martin Luther King Park where they can burn off some energy on the playground or on one of a few sports amenities like the basketball courts. The park has been used during spring break as one of several designated spots across the city for children to receive free meals. Residents of both Winburn and Griffin Gate can also let their pets roam at Coldstream Park off Newtown Pike or take to the trails around the moss-covered pond. Cyclists riding along the 12-mile Legacy Trail can use the park as a brief stopping point as the path runs right past the green space. Both Winburn and Griffin Gate have the fortune of being right next door to a relatively new event celebrating one of the state’s most famous commodities. Many in the city look forward to BourbonCon, which started in January 2023 and takes place at the Marriott. Those who book tickets for the weekend-long event can sample whiskeys from more than 30 distilleries. Another event with a dedicated and growing following is the LexiCon Tabletop Gaming Convention, which takes place in April at the Clarion Hotel Conference Center - North. Much of the homes on Winburn’s residential blocks back into groups of trees. Common builds include brick ranch-style houses from the 1960s and 1970s, as well as more modern single-story houses with Craftsman and Traditional features. Price points can go from just over $160,000 for a 1970s ranch-style house to nearly $255,000 for a house with Craftsman touches and that was built in the 2010s. A remodeled ranch-style house can also fall on the upper end of that range. Griffin Gate features more Traditional builds, many of which are townhouses and patio homes — attached houses that are often no taller than a single story. Some of the community’s homes can be quite opulent, featuring distinct details like older stone, brick and vinyl siding. “Each section of Griffin Gate has its own little character,” Winger says. Price points in this pocket of Lexington can go from about $350,000 for a two-bedroom townhouse to $450,000 for a house located right along the course.Bryan Station High and district’s only Air Force JROTC program
Public schools serving part of Lexington include Mary Todd Elementary School, Winburn Middle School and Bryan Station High School, which respectively received grades of B-minus, B and B from ratings site Niche. Among Bryan Station High’s extracurricular activities is Fayette County Public Schools’ only Air Force JROTC program. The high school also houses the StationArts program, which attracts students from across the city. Both Winburn and Griffin Gate lie just south of Interstate 64, which provides a fast route to the other communities and destinations on the eastern end of Lexington. That includes the Hamburg Area and its regional shopping destination to the south. I-64 connects to Interstate 75, which runs past the Kentucky Horse Park to the north. Several Lextran bus stops exist within Winburn. Both communities sit about a 10-mile drive east of the Blue Grass Airport. Both neighborhoods are also about a 6-mile drive north of the downtown Lexington medical campus that includes the Albert B. Chandler Hospital.
